Children’s Ministry Coordinator

Home Moravian Church seeks a part-time Children’s Ministry Coordinator.  The Children’s Ministry Coordinator oversees all children’s ministries for children aged 3 to 10 (5th grade)This ministry position includes oversight of volunteers serving in our children’s areas with the sole purpose of leading all children to a foundational authentic relationship with Jesus Christ. Ministry areas include: 

• Children’s Sunday School
• Mid-week Children’s Programming
• Godly Play (a Montessori-based curriculum used in Children’s Church)
• Special / seasonal events that promote the mission and vision of Home Moravian Church and its Children’s Ministry

 

In coordination with the HMC children’s ministry team and other volunteers from the congregation, the Children’s Ministry Coordinator will: 

• recruit and train volunteers to lead effective children’s ministry work
• schedule volunteers for all children’s ministry programs and events
• in conjunction with the Director of Christian Education (DCE)select and implement all curriculum for the children’s ministry programs
• plan programming to meet goals for engagement of children and their parents
• connect with children in a way that helps them to forge strong bonds with each other, with those working with them, and with God
• work in conjunction with the DCE to create a Children’s Ministry annual budget
• welcome new families with children at Home Moravian Church 
• build relationships with the larger church community, including other Moravian churches
• attend to other tasks related to the children’s ministry

 

Time commitment: 20 hours a week on average, with half of the time typically spent in planning and working with the Children’s Ministry Team and volunteers, and the other half spent in direct engagement opportunities with children

Preferred Qualifications: 

• BA (any field)
• Minimum 23 years of age 
• experience leading and organizing children in a ministry setting. 
• exemplary Christian model through teaching, discipling, and generosity
• theology and practice consistent with Moravian approach to faith

 

Classification:  Part-time position approximately 20 hours per week 

Salary: Compensation is $25/hour.

Administrative Assistant

Home Moravian Church 

Job Summary

The Administrative Assistant provides administrative support to Home Church’s program staff (pastor, associate pastor, director of Christian formation, and music director) and is the primary staff person interacting with members and the public when they contact the church office.  This position reports to the pastor, who is head of staff.

Illustrative examples of duties:

  • Performs clerical work for program staff
  • Maintains membership records (both paper and digital); keeps attendance records; insures that required church records are provided to the Moravian Archives. 
  • Coordinates church calendar for all activities and schedules use of church facilities.
  • Creates print materials including worship bulletins, monthly church newsletter, and congregational mailings. 
  • Prepares bulk mail and other special mailings. 
  • As needed, assists communications coordinator with congregational emails and with preparation of weekly electronic newsletter. 
  • Answers phone (with the assistance of front office volunteers) and keeps outgoing messages and phone tree up to date
  • Purchases supplies as needed for office and for some worship services

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Demonstrated ability to work with others--staff, volunteers and visitors--in an office setting, and to manage basic office functions
  • Experience in handling funds in a professional, confidential, and accurate manner.
  • Ability to work effectively in a Windows-based computer environment, including word processing and basic database management
  • Ability to give attention to countless small (but important) details
  • A spirit of cooperativeness; the flexibility to function in a wide variety of situations and with a sincere respect for all persons; and a sense of humor
  • Ability to work selflessly with other staff members to accomplish tasks; to value cooperation to achieve a goal; and to receive direction willingly.  
  • It is imperative that this person be able to maintain confidentiality.

 

Other:

  • The position requires availability to work regular hours Monday through Friday as determined upon hiring.
  • All staff members are required to abide by the most recent edition of the Employee Handbook of Home Moravian Church.
  • All staff members are required to act in a manner consistent with the values and overall mission of Home Moravian Church.

This is a full-time, salaried position with benefits.  Salary range: 38,000-42,000, depending on experience.
